What Is PenTest+?

Pentest+, offered by CompTIA, is a vendor-neutral certification that validates the knowledge and skills of cybersecurity professionals in conducting penetration testing and vulnerability management. This certification is designed to assess proficiency in areas such as planning and scoping, information gathering and vulnerability identification, attacks and exploits, and report writing.

Career Opportunities

With your PenTest+ certification, various job roles become viable options for you. Some of the potential career paths include:

Penetration Tester: Penetration testers are responsible for conducting security assessments on computer systems, networks, and web applications. They evaluate the security posture of organizations by simulating real-world attacks, identifying vulnerabilities, and recommending remediation techniques.

Vulnerability Assessment Analyst: As a vulnerability assessment analyst, your primary role will be to identify and assess vulnerabilities within an organization's systems and networks. You will utilize tools and techniques to assess potential risks and provide recommendations for enhancing security controls.

Security Consultant: Security consultants provide guidance and expertise in developing comprehensive security strategies for organizations. With your PenTest+ certification, you can offer valuable insights on potential vulnerabilities and suggest mitigation measures.

Network Security Engineer: Network security engineers ensure the security of an organization's computer systems, networks, and data. They are responsible for identifying vulnerabilities, implementing security measures, and monitoring systems for any suspicious activities.

Salary Prospects

The earning potential for professionals with PenTest+ certification is quite promising. According to the Bureau of Labor Statistics, the median annual wage for information security analysts, a common role pursued by PenTest+ certified professionals, was $103,590 in May 2020. However, salaries may vary depending on factors such as experience, location, and organization.

5. Do I need any prerequisites to pursue PenTest+ certification?

While there are no strict prerequisites for taking the PenTest+ exam, it is recommended to have some prior experience and knowledge in network and security concepts. It is also beneficial to have other cybersecurity certifications, such as Security+ or CEH (Certified Ethical Hacker), as they can provide a solid foundation for understanding penetration testing principles before pursuing PenTest+ certification.
